Messages allow you to communicate with users from your programs. They are mainly used when the user has made an invalid entry on a screen.
To send messages from a program, you must link it to a message class. Each message class has an ID, and usually contains a whole set of message. Each message has a single line of text, and may contain placeholders for variables.
All messages are stored in table T100. You create and edit them using Transaction SE91. Once you have created a message, you can use it in the MESSAGE statement in a program.

Starting the Message Maintenance Transaction

Note

If you choose Goto ® Messages from the ABAP Editor and your program does not have a defined message class, the system assumes you want to browse an existing class and prompts you for a message class ID.
